Many American professional athletes have opted to skip the Summer Olympic Games in Rio de Janeiro, Brazil, due to the rising fears surrounding the Zika virus. According to USA Today, tennis powerhouse Serena Williams said she thinks it's “sad” that so many athletes are missing out on the opportunity.
